Background:

Using the new scalable node auditing system, we are looking to scale to a point where we are vetting new nodes within 14-21 days. Historically (2022) it was taking us on average 60 days to vet a new node on US1, 58 on EU1, and 86 on AP1.

Historical data: https://redash.datasci.storj.io/dashboard/vetting?p_FILTER=created_at&p_PERIOD=month

Acceptance Criteria:

  • Double the number of audit workers/pods currently running
    • Currently 4 workers per pod, 1 pod per satellite
  • Let it sit as-is for ~3 weeks to gather new node vetting time metrics
  • Confirm we are hitting our new target vetting times
    • If not, bring it to the project team to determine how far off we are and what additional changes should be made
